littlebot
Published on 2025-04-11 / 1 Visits
0

【源码】基于Arduino的闪烁融合阈值测试系统

项目简介

本项目是为2020年嵌入式系统课程设计的原型系统,借助Arduino平台搭建可测量个体主观闪烁融合阈率的嵌入式系统。用户能通过电位计调节LED灯闪烁频率,找到自身闪烁融合阈率,再通过按钮确认并在串行监视器显示。

项目的主要特性和功能

硬件组件

  • Teensy 3.2开发板
  • 10kΩ电位计
  • 内置LED
  • 按钮

软件功能

  • 可通过电位计调节LED的闪烁频率。
  • 具备按钮去抖动处理。
  • 能将电位计的模拟信号映射到LED的闪烁频率。
  • 可通过串行通信输出当前频率和选择的频率。

测试与验证

  • 可使用SerialPlot程序验证闪烁频率。
  • 能计算并输出频率误差。

安装使用步骤

硬件连接

  • 将电位计连接到Teensy 3.2的A0引脚。
  • 将按钮连接到Teensy 3.2的12引脚。
  • 用USB线连接Teensy 3.2到电脑。

软件设置

  • 打开Arduino IDE,选择Teensy 3.2作为开发板。
  • 将项目代码上传到Teensy 3.2。

运行系统

  • 打开串行监视器,设置波特率为115200。
  • 旋转电位计调节LED的闪烁频率。
  • 当找到无法察觉闪烁的频率时,按下按钮保存并显示该频率。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】